How can you recognise penetrating damp in the house?
Recognising penetrating damp is not always an easy task. This is mainly because this type of damp problem can occur in places in the house that are difficult to reach. Places where you dont usually go and where the damp problem can damage the house unnoticed. Any type of damp can be recognised mainly by the musty smell in the house, it is not always easily visible.
Damaged exterior walls - Fixrot.co.uk
Damaged walls can also allow damp to penetrate easily from the outside to the inside. Cracks and holes in the brickwork are weak spots that cause damp to permeate into the house. At first, there can be small cracks in the outside wall, but because of the damp, these can become bigger and bigger, which makes the damp problem even worse. Damaged outer walls therefore need to be repaired quickly; this is especially the case with old houses.
Help needed on how to treat woodworm in painted wood?
Any previous finish such as varnish, stain or paint should be completely removed prior to treating with a woodworm treatment. Once the woodworm treatment has been applied to all areas and allowed to dry, the wood can be re-coated or painted. Some people manage by only removing the paint from the affected area then treating. The potential problem with this is that the woodworm may have penetrated further than the area treated, and the re-finished area may not totally blend in with the old finish.
Cracks around windows and frames - Fixrot.co.uk
There can also be cracks and weak spots around windows and window frames, these weak spots cause water to penetrate from outside to inside. The same goes for missing sills around doors and windows. It is often quite a task to discover the exact cause of leakage of damp in the house. In most cases it is a combination of several factors. In addition, damp damage can occur in several places in the house and can usually be traced back to just one cause.

Remove The Dry Rot - Fixrot.co.uk
Other than wet wood, you should check for rotten wood. The rot dry repair shouldn't start without removing the dry rot. Wet wood leads to rupture but rotten wood will prevent adhesive to work. You should use a chisel or cutter to remove dry rot. In case of wood fibers or dirt, you should remove it using sandpaper.

Damp Proofing vs Waterproofing - Fixrot.co.uk
Damp proofing is a solution for a property when the external ground level is lower than the floor level inside the building. When the earth around is lower, the risk of pressurized water ingress is reduced, and here you can apply damp proofing. For example, when dampness is found you could apply a damp proofing membrane that can manage the capillary held moisture applicable in the case of walls and floors.

Identify The Difference Between Wet And Dry Rot,
It is rather difficult to identify the difference between Wet and Dry rot, but its also crucial that an infestation is correctly identified. Different types of Rot require different treatment methods and have different rates of growth spread patterns. Since Dry Rot is far more devastating and widespread, its an immediate danger to a structural integrity of your house.

Why is Dry Rot Outbreak so Serious?
Dry Rot leaves wood extremely brittle, resulting in structural weakness and loss of construction stability. In areas with high moisture levels, Dry Rot can spread incredibly quickly and sometimes even affect materials other than wood. It releases a large amount of spores into the air affecting occupants health. It can be difficult to notice Dry Rot as it usually affects poorly ventilated places such as the inside of walls, under floorboards and other areas hidden from direct view. WHAT EXACTLY IS DAMP PROOFING?
What is damp proofing? In short, damp proofing is a generic term to describe the variety of damp proofing treatments applied to prevent damp problems affecting your property. However, damp proofing is more commonly known as a type of waterproofing for constructed walls where a damp proofing barrier (commonly known as a damp proof course or DPC) is placed in walls or floors.

The Best Way to Tackle Rising Damp - Fixrot.co.uk
Whenever rising damp is diagnosed, it is vital to have the condition correctly treated, as failure to do so can cause a great deal of damage and devaluation to any property, not to mention the health risks involved, like asthma. It is not sufficient to simply cover up the problem with a special paint in the hope that the problem will go away. Only by preventing the dampness rising up the wall in the first place can rising dampness be adequately contained.
Damp Proofing a Building Depending on Construction - Fixrot
Damp proofing of both domestic and commercial structures, although not the most glamorous aspect of a construction project, is still a vital part of the build process to get right. New build properties will, unless there has been a negligent moment by a contractor or architect, will have a physical isolation membrane around 150mm above external ground level (a damp proof course or DPC). This acts to prevent capillary movement of moisture rising higher than the barrier and effectively damp proofs the property above this barrier. So if the building has no earth bridging above the DPC and no leaking pipes, gutters or flashing, then you should have no problems in terms of damp proofing. Its all relatively straight forward.
